    ext4: fix deadlock in ext4_symlink() in ENOSPC conditions · df5e6223
    Jan Kara authored
    
    
    ext4_symlink() cannot call __page_symlink() with transaction open.
    __page_symlink() calls ext4_write_begin() which can wait for
    transaction commit if we are running out of space thus causing a
    deadlock. Also error recovery in ext4_truncate_failed_write() does not
    count with the transaction being already started (although I'm not
    aware of any particular deadlock here).
    
    Fix the problem by stopping a transaction before calling
    __page_symlink() (we have to be careful and put inode to orphan list
    so that it gets deleted in case of crash) and starting another one
    after __page_symlink() returns for addition of symlink into a
    directory.
